Was going to have mushy peas and maybe sw roast potatoes, does anyone have the recipe for SW mushy pea curry? x
 
I don't know :(
Was going to have mushy peas and maybe sw roast potatoes, does anyone have the recipe for SW mushy pea curry? x

This is how i do it - if using frozen mushy peas cook as normal, in the mean time fry off some onion and garlic with 2 tb sp curry powder(of your choice) and a tin of tomatoes, when the peas are cooked add the tomatoes etc and also a tin of beans , heat and serve. I've used this as a base and had it with chicken or quorn before now very nom! enjoy
